Output 84c856f34bcc8e871c4bf89e80328fb694eb9ddeba220089194a6e3273fd4d61:0

value
66107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5800251ee0571751180b116f0c98518e55b3572c OP_EQUAL
address
39iKZVwVPNvsMsjBkQzSKWLjSTx7jnrFkN
transaction
84c856f34bcc8e871c4bf89e80328fb694eb9ddeba220089194a6e3273fd4d61